TypeSpec:云服务API的描述语言
talkingdev • 2024-01-24
1050397 views
TypeSpec是一种描述云服务API并生成其他API描述语言、客户端和服务端代码、文档和其他资源的语言。它提供了高度可扩展的核心语言原语,可以描述REST、OpenAPI、GraphQL、gRPC和其他协议中常见的API形状。TypeSpec可以创建可重用的模式,为API设计人员建立了防范措施,使其易于遵循最佳实践。有一个游乐场可供尝试TypeSpec而无需安装任何内容。
核心要点
- TypeSpec是一种描述云服务API的语言
- TypeSpec可以生成其他API描述语言、客户端和服务端代码、文档和其他资源
- TypeSpec可以创建可重用的模式,为API设计人员建立了防范措施